Safety study of a new drug for Parkinson's disease

Healthy Volunteers (HV)Parkinson's Disease (PD)

Part of Brain & nervous system clinical trials.

This trial tests a new drug called VT-5006 to see if it is safe for people with Parkinson's disease. It focuses on those who have stomach or bowel issues, like constipation.

Phase
Phase 1
Enrollment
84 people
Ages
18 years to 80 years
Study type
Interventional

Who can take part

  • You have been diagnosed with Parkinson's disease within the last 10 years
  • You currently have or have had slow stomach emptying or ongoing constipation
  • You are able to swallow multiple large pills without help
  • You are on a stable dose of your regular medications (except certain Parkinson's drugs) for at least 60 days before the study starts
  • You are not taking any of the following Parkinson's drugs: levodopa/carbidopa, levodopa/benserazide, or anticholinergic agents
